§ 70121. — 70121. (Amended by Stats. 2004, Ch. 788, Sec. 22.)
California·Code PUC Public Utilities Code - PUC·Div. 10. DIVISION 10. TRANSIT DISTRICTS·Part 7. PART 7. MARIN COUNTY TRANSIT DISTRICT·Ch. 4. CHAPTER 4. Labor Provisions
(a)A contract or agreement shall not be made, or assumed, with any labor organization, association, group, or individual that denies membership to, or in any manner discriminates against, any employee on any basis listed in subdivision (a) of Section 12940 of the Government Code, as those bases are defined in Sections 12926 and 12926.1 of the Government Code. However, the organization may preclude from membership any individual who advocates the overthrow of the government by force or violence.
